Revit stands out with a BIM-first workflow that turns Ff&E specification into a coordinated model. It supports parametric families and schedules for documenting furniture, equipment, and finish-related elements. Strong interoperability with other Autodesk and BIM toolchains helps keep specifications aligned with architectural intent and change cycles.

Navisworks stands out as a 3D project review tool that connects design models into a single coordination space for measurable construction and procurement decisions. Its core workflow supports model aggregation, clash detection, and time-sliced simulations, which can support Ff&E planning from early layout to validation. For Ff&E specification work, it helps teams verify that model-placed assets align with spatial constraints and interfaces before specification packages are finalized. It does not replace a dedicated specification database or master data workflow for producing catalog-ready Ff&E schedules.

What Is Ff&E Specification Software?
Ff&E specification software supports the creation, structuring, and management of furniture, fixtures, and equipment requirements documents and schedules. These tools reduce manual transcription of product attributes into specs and coordinate changes between design intent, procurement inputs, and documentation outputs. Many workflows use BIM objects, schedules, and room context to drive quantities and selection. Revit and BIMobject show what this looks like in practice by combining model-based furniture data with specification-ready attributes.
